A two-stage approach for optimizing the robust injection molding parameters

Abstract

In this paper, a two-stage approach is proposed for optimizing the robust injection molding parameters. In the first-stage optimization, the simplex method is used to search for qualified parameters when the starting parameter is disqualified. In the second-stage optimization, forgetting factor recursive least square algorithm is used to build the model between process parameters and quality index. Robust parameters are obtained by using the steepest ascent method based on the model. Time and experiment costs are saved by using the two-stage approach. Experiments and results on mold flow analysis software show its validity.
